Definitions

  • the present invention relates to a method for supplying a semi-finished product made of elastomeric material used for manufacturing a rubber item.
  • the present invention relates to a method for supplying a semifinished product on the surface of an assembly drum used for manufacturing a rubber item.
  • the present invention relates to a method for supplying a semifinished product used in a process for manufacturing a tire.
  • the invention relates to an apparatus for supplying said semi-finished product.
  • the expression "semi-finished product” indicates an elongated element, i.e. having a prevailing dimension (length) with respect to the other two dimensions (width and thickness), made of elastomeric material, having constant thickness or a thickness variable along a transversal direction with respect to the same semi-finished product, used -jointly with other elements - as component of a rubber item.
  • Such semi-finished product may be a tape, i.e. an element solely consisting of elastomeric material, or a ribbon, i.e. an element comprising threads, cords, fibers or other reinforcing elements at least partly embedded within a tape of said elastomeric material.
  • elastomeric material indicates the rubber mixture as a whole, i.e. the mixture formed by at least a polymer base suitably mixed with reinforcing fillers and/or process additives of various types.
  • a tire comprises: a torically shaped reinforcing carcass comprising at least one carcass ply having ends associated to a pair of bead wires forming the reinforcement of the beads, i.e. portions of the tire coupled to the wheel rim; a pair of sidewalks, made of elastomeric material and superposed to said carcass ply at laterally opposite positions; a tread crown-arranged around said carcass, and a reinforcing structure, known as belt structure, arranged between the aforementioned carcass ply and the tread.
  • the elastomeric material as such is used, for example, for producing the sidewalls, the tread and the airproof layer, technically called liner, which internally coats the carcass of a tubeless tire, i.e. which does not require the use of an air tube.
  • the liner is generally coupled to a additional layer having limited thickness, of elastomeric material as well, which carries out the function of facilitating the adhesion between the liner itself and the carcass ply.
  • the bead-reinforcing edges, the carcass ply and the belt structure comprise, on the other hand, a reinforcing structure embedded in the elastomeric material, said structure being constituted by a plurality of textile or metal threads or cords arranged according to suitable angles with respect to the circumferential direction of the tire.
  • the aforementioned semi-finished products are supplied, according to a specific sequence of steps, to an assembly machine generally comprising at least one assembly drum on which said semi-finished products are arranged and assembled with one another to form the finished tire.
  • Said assembly machine is served by a plurality of auxiliary apparatuses (feeders) adapted to feed to the assembly drum all the different types of semi-finished products required by the assembly process.
  • auxiliary apparatuses feeders
  • the semi-finished products are unwound by respective storing a d feeding spools, and conveyed on said drums where the manual or automatic arrangement of a first end of the semi-finished product, or of the first ends in the case of simultaneous unwinding of more strips of material, such as for example the sidewalls and the under- belt fillings, is accomplished.
  • the drum is rotated until the same accomplishes a partial winding of the semi-finished product on the generally cylindrical surface of the assembly drum.
  • Said rotation is not completely performed so that the semi-finished product may undergo an operation of cutting to size and may be afterwards spliced, manually or automatically, by coupling the second end, obtained by said cutting operation, to the first end previously bound to the drum surface.
  • Such splicing of the first and second ends may be of the butt splicing type, or may comprise a partial overlapping of the ends along a portion of limited length.
  • first-step drum whereon the arrangement of the pair of bead wires is also carried out
  • second- step drum downstream of which the green tire is already completed and ready to undergo a vulcanization process at the end of which the finished tire is obtained.
  • the manufacturing processes of the semi-finished products involve a step of associating such semi-finished products to at least one protective sheet adapted to maintain the surface of the semi-finished product as free as possible from dust or other impurities with which such elements may come into contact during the traditional storing and/or transport steps, in order to preserve the adhesiveness of the same semifinished products, which is essential for the subsequent reciprocal assembly.
  • said protective sheet generally defined as "release fabric” mainly consists of a textile material, such as for example Meraclon®, and the same is generally coupled to the semi-finished product, manufactured in a continuous way, for example by extrusion, calendering or profiling, downstream of said manufacturing step.
  • the semi-finished product, associated to the release fabric, is thus wound in concentric turns around a cylindrical surface, such as for example the core of a storing spool; said storing spools, each loaded with a specific semi-finished product, being then loaded on the assembly machine, in particular arranged in the apparatus for supplying such semifinished products to the aforementioned assembly drums.
  • each semi-finished product is unwound from the respective storing spool and detached from the release fabric to which the semifinished product has been previously coupled, so that only the semi-finished product continues its path towards the assembly drum, whereas the release fabric is recovered to be reused.
  • the present description refers to a method for supplying a semi-fmished product made of elastomeric material and to an apparatus for accomplishing such operation as provided in the assembly process of a tire. More particularly, the present description relates to the step of detaching the release fabric from the semi-finished product to which the fabric is coupled.
  • the operating techniques of the aforementioned drums and, in general, of an assembly machine as a whole shall not be described hereinafter since they are known in the art and not relevant for the purposes of the present invention.
  • the prior art teaches to carry out such detaching process of a release fabric from a semi-finished product of elastomeric material by using a detachment device, such as for example an idle roll. More in detail, the semi-finished product, coupled to the release fabric, is unwound from the corresponding storing spool and brought on the surface of said detachment element, where a sudden change of direction of the release fabric with respect to the conveying direction of the semifinished product is determined, so as to facilitate the detachment of the release fabric from the semi-finished product.
  • the release fabric is thus conveyed towards a collecting device, usually a beam, which is rotated by a motor.
  • the aforementioned storing spool is interconnected to a braking device so that, during unwinding and as a consequence of the variation of the amount of semi-finished product wound around the spool and thus of the weight of the same, the spool does not undergo substantial changes of its speed of rotation and, more particularly, does not increase its speed, thus causing ' an accumulation of semi-finished product upstream of said idle roll, thus counterbalancing, at least partly, the pulling action exerted by the collecting beam and making the aforementioned detachment process more difficult.
  • the collecting beam of the release fabric is suitably controlled by a control device or clutch, so that as the mass of the release fabric wound around the beam surface increases, the speed of said collecting beam may be varied in time for ensuring a substantially constant pulling action on the release fabric, in order to extract the aforementioned semi-finished product as evenly as possible.
  • the supply of the semi-finished product to the assembly drum is controlled by the pull exerted on the release fabric by said motorized collecting beam.
  • the Applicant has perceived that, in order to preserve the dimensional and structural characteristics of a semi-fmished product, which is in the plastic state and thus easily deformable, the supply of said semi-fmished product from a respective storing spool should be carried out so as to avoid to exert stretches on the semi-finished product itself in the steps of spool unwinding, detachment of the release fabric and transport of said semi-finished product to the assembly drum or to another assembly and/or handling device of the semi-finished products.
  • the aforementioned stretches cause such stresses within the semifinished product as to cause a modification of the size and functional features of the latter, thus impairing the outcome or, in any case, making the assembly process more difficult, particularly when carried out with an automatic apparatus.
  • the Applicant has found that it is possible to substantially eliminate stretches and deformations imparted to the semi-finished product by using a guiding and detachment device of the fabric comprising a plurality of rolls, of which at least one is motorized, in place of the idle roll of the prior art, the semi-finished product being preferably associated to an inextensible release fabric.
  • Such guiding and detachment device of the fabric hereinafter defined also as pull capstan, applies a pulling action on the fabric at the same point in which the fabric detachment from the semi-finished product occurs.
  • the traction force developed by the collecting beam and by said capstan is totally absorbed by the inextensible release fabric and is not transferred, neither partially, to the semi-finished product during the unwinding step from the storing spool.
  • the Applicant has found that, by providing such plurality of rolls and motorizing at least one of said rolls, by means of said at least one roll it is possible to impart to said semi-finished product, once the latter has been freed from the release fabric, a translation speed substantially equal to that imparted to the same semi-finished product by the conveying means arranged upstream of the assembly drum and adapted to convey such semi-finished product towards said drum.
  • the Applicant has found that, by moving at least one roll of the pull capstan with a rotation speed equal to that of a plurality of additional rolls arranged downstream of said device and belonging to the aforementioned conveying means, called in the art "roll and stand table", the translation speed of the semi-finished product leaving the feeding spool is equal to the translation speed of the semi-finished product at said stands.
  • the guiding and detachment device of the fabric according to the invention ensures a transfer of the semi-finished product at a constant and predetermined speed, said semi-finished product being not pushed nor dragged. Such fact enables to prevent the appearance of stretches within the semi-finished product itself.

  • the following description refers to a method and to an apparatus for supplying a semifinished product made of elastomeric material used in a process for assembling a tire, for example a giant tire 100 illustrated in Fig. 1.
  • the method and the apparatus according to the invention are not limited to a process for assembling a tire, but they may be applied to " any type of process requiring a step of supplying a semi-finished product made of a plastically deformable material, such as the elastomeric material.
  • the tire 100 comprises a torically shaped carcass including at least one carcass ply 101 provided with preferably metallic reinforcing cords lying in radial planes, i.e. containing the rotation axis of the tire.
  • the ends 101a of the carcass ply are axially turned up, from the inside outwardly, around two metallic annular cores 102, usually known as bead cores, which form the reinforcement of the bead, i.e. of the radially inner ends of said tire.
  • the beads ensure that the tire may be assembled onto a corresponding mounting rim C.
  • the tire 100 is supported on a so-called "channeled" rim, in which the supporting bases for the tire beads are outwardly conically diverging according to an angle w equal to about 15°.
  • the tread 103 has a thickness of predetermined value and is delimited between an outer surface, intended to come in contact with the ground, and an inner surface coated with a thin sheet 103', made of elastomeric material specifically adapted to promote the necessary adhesion between the tread 103 and the underlying belt structure 104.
  • the aforementioned belt structure is an annular reinforcing structure, circumferentially almost inextensible, arranged between the carcass 101 and the tread 103.
  • said belt comprises at least two radially superposed layers 104a, 104b, made of rubber- coated fabric, internally provided with metal reinforcing cords.
  • Such cords are arranged in parallel with one another in each layer 104a, 104b and inclined with respect to the cords of an adjacent layer; preferably, such cords are symmetrically arranged with respect to the equatorial plane of the tire.
  • the aforementioned belt structure comprises an additional third layer 104c of metal cords of the high-elongation type, circumferentially wound around the underlying belt layers for the entire width, or only at the axially outer positions of the latter so as to enclose only the ends of said underlying belt layers.
  • additional layer in cooperation with the underlying layers, increases the ability of the belt to withstand the stresses acting on the tire during operation and linked to the inflation pressure and to the centrifugal force, and of ensuring high driving performances, in particular during curve running.
  • Figure 2 shows an apparatus 10 according to the invention, adapted to supply a semifinished product 2 made of elastomeric material, for example a tread or a sidewall, stored in a storing spool 6 from which the semi-finished product is drawn and conveyed towards an assembly drum 3, rotated by a motor 4 after the separation from a release fabric 5, recovered by a collecting device 20.
  • a semifinished product 2 made of elastomeric material, for example a tread or a sidewall
  • the semi-finished product 2 is associated to a protective sheet, or release fabric 5 which, according to the present invention, is made of a substantially inextensible material and has such features as to maintain the adhesiveness of the semifinished product 2 unchanged, but to adhere to said semi-fmished product quite weakly, so that the detachment step from the latter is not difficult.
  • the Applicant has found it advantageous to use a sheet of a material commercially known with the name of Mylar®.
  • the semi-finished product 2 is manufactured in a special plant, for example an extruder, and the same is immediately associated to the release fabric 5; then the semi-finished product 2 is wound in concentric turns around a storing spool 6, ready for the subsequent use.
  • the spool 6 is loaded on the assembly plant, in particular on a feeding apparatus of the semi- finished products, and the free end of the release fabric is brought on a collecting device 20. The aforementioned device is rotated for carrying out the unwinding of said turns from the spool 6 and the recovery of said fabric.
  • the rotation of the spool is adjusted by a braking device 7 which, as mentioned above, enables to maintain the peripheral tangential speed of the storing spool constant at any moment of the unwinding step, both when the spool possesses the maximum diameter, since the unwinding has just begun and the semifinished product completely loads the spool, and when the spool possesses the minimum diameter since the unwinding has almost completely finished and the spool is almost empty.
  • the apparatus 10 comprises a spool 6, a braking device 7 for said spool, a beam 20 for collecting the release fabric 5, a motor 21 adapted to impart a suitable rotation speed to the aforementioned beam, and three guiding devices of the fabric, preferably three rolls 17, 18, 19 around which the release fabric 5 is wound during the path from the spool 6 to the beam 20.
  • the rolls 17, 18, 19 preferably have the same diameter and guide the release fabric 5 along an undulated path which will be described hereinbelow in the present description.
  • storing spool and “collecting beam” do not have a limiting purpose, but they are used, in order to simplify the description, for indicating any type of device, respectively for storing the semi-fmished product and collecting the release fabric, usable as an alternative to said spool and beam, such as for example a storing beam and a collecting spool of the fabric.
  • Figure 2 a roll table 22 and a stand 8, the stand 8 being also provided with a series of rolls, for conveying the semi-finished product 2 onto the cylindrical surface of said drum 3 are shown.
  • Figure 2 shows a partial schematic view of the supplying apparatus according to the invention, this figure does not take account of the real distances existing between the spool 6 and the assembly drum 3, and the same does not show a plurality of additional known elements which do not fall within the scope of the present invention.
  • Figure 2 does not show the conveyor belt system (one or more) generally present for supporting the semi-finished product in its path from the detachment device of the fabric to the roll table.
  • Figure 2 does not show the festoon system arranged between the feeding spool 6 and the roll table 22, required for separating the supply zone of the semi-finished product from its handling zone; for example, such system enables to carry out a change of the spool without interrupting the manufacturing cycle, i.e. ensuring a continuous feeding to the assembly drum 3.
  • the axes of the spool 6, of the beam 20 and of the rolls 17, 18, 19, as well as those of the rolls 22 of the table and of the stand 8, are all parallel to one another, and perpendicular to a common support frame of the feeder of the semi-finished product, represented by the plane of Figure 2.
  • the rolls 17, 18 and 19 are arranged in such a way as to guide the release fabric 5 along an undulated path adapted to facilitate a stretchless supply of the semi-finished product.
  • At least one of said rolls constitutes the detachment device between the semi-finished product 2 and the release fabric 5, since the same imposes different advancing directions to said fabric and to said semi-fmished product.
  • the advancing directions of the semi-finished product and of the fabric are made to diverge from one another of an angle preferably not lower than 60°, and more preferably, next to 90°.
  • At least one of the aforementioned rolls is motorized, so as to apply a traction force to said release fabric, in addition to or in replacement of the force exerted by the beam, for accomplishing the aforementioned braked unwinding of the turns of the semifinished product from the storing spool, so that - as mentioned above - the se i- finished product 2 may be transferred from the spool 6 to the assembly drum 3 at a constant speed, without causing stretches on the same semi-finished product.
  • the first roll 17 is moved by a motor 23.
  • the motorized roll or rolls are rotated at a constant speed having a value which is a function of the diameter of the same rolls, such diameter being preferably comprised between 40 mm and 80 mm.
  • the outer surface of said rolls is preferably coated with an elastomeric material of high hardness (for example, a hardness comprised between 60° and 70° Shore A) in order to increase the friction between the roll and the release fabric, thus facilitating the pulling action on the latter.
  • said guiding devices are three and are arranged with their axes substantially matching with the vertices of an overturned triangle having a side facing the semi-finished product 2, moving towards the assembly drum after the detachment of the release fabric 5.
  • said side forms a small angle with the conveying direction A of the semi-finished product 2 so that only the detachment device (roll 17) is in contact with said release fabric.
  • the spatial configuration of the aforementioned rolls 17, 18, 19 is such that the release fabric 5 follows an undulated path determined by the two sides of said triangle not facing the semi-finished product, i.e. those represented by the line joining the axes of the rolls 17-18 and 18-19.
  • the roll 19 is spaced apart from the semi-finished product 2 so as not to interfere with the travel of said semi-finished product.
  • the method for supplying a semi-finished product 2 towards an assembly drum 3 thus involves the unwinding of said semi-fmished product coupled to the release fabric from a storing spool 6.
  • the semi-fmished product 2 and the release fabric 5 coupled to the same are moved (arrow B of Figure 2) towards the first roll 17 by the pulling action exerted on the fabric by the collecting beam 20 and/or by the roll 17.
  • the release fabric is detached from the semi-finished product 2 at the first roll 17 and is forced to follow an undulated path (arrows C, E, F) around the subsequent rolls 18, 19 up to its collection onto the beam 20.
  • the semi-finished product 2 proceeds (arrow A) towards the assembly drum 3 once the same has been separated from the release fabric 5.
  • the release fabric 5 comes in contact at first surface thereof with a curvilinear portion of the rolls 17 and 19 and at the opposite surface with a curvilinear portion of the roll 18.
  • curvilinear portions correspond to a surface arc of the roll comprised between 90° and 180° but, more preferably, not less than 135°.
  • Such configuration of triangular type with the corresponding undulated path with sudden direction changes imposed to the release fabric 5 transforms the rolls assembly in a pull capstan capable of exerting on the fabric a pulling action of a constant and high value, usable in combination with or in replacement of the pulling action exerted by the beam 20.
  • the semi-finished product 2 is associated to a release fabric 5 made of inextensible material and thus capable of withstanding the pulling action applied by said capstan or by said beam without undergoing any elongation.
  • said release fabric 5 is made of Mylar® and has a thickness comprised between 0.1 mm and 0.5 mm.
  • Figure 3 shows an additional embodiment of the apparatus 10 according to the present invention, specifically applicable when the semi-finished product 2 (arrow B) is provided with a pair of release fabrics respectively arranged on both surfaces of the semi- finished product.
  • the semi-finished product 2 for example, the sidewalls or the metal fabric tapes in the case of a process for manufacturing a giant tire
  • the semi-finished product 2 is provided with a first release fabric 5 arranged on one of its surfaces as illustrated in Figure 2, and with a second release fabric 5', generally different from the fabric 5 and constituted by a polyethylene film.
  • the second release fabric 5' and the first release fabric 5 carry out the aforementioned protective functions on the two opposite surfaces of the semi-finished product 2.
  • the first release fabric 5 is detached by means of an apparatus 10 according to the present invention, and the same is sent (arrow C) to a collecting beam, not shown.
  • the second release fabric 5' is detached by a separation device 9 of the so-called knife type, which is fixed with respect to the support frame, and conveyed (arrow D) to a different collecting beam 11.
  • the roll 19 is arranged at the same level as the roll 17 with respect to the surface of the semi-finished product, so that also such roll 19 contacts the semi-fmished product 2.
  • Said embodiment is particularly advantageous when also the roll 19 is of motorized type, thus facilitating the transfer at predetermined and constant speed of the semifinished product 2 (arrow A) towards the assembly drum 3.
  • the apparatus 10 further comprises a support element 12 (for example, a roll table or a conveyor belt) interposed between the rolls 17 and 19 and adapted to provide a support plane parallel to the semi-finished product 2 traveling (arrow A) towards an assembly drum (not shown).
  • a support element 12 for example, a roll table or a conveyor belt
  • Such support element 12 carries out the function of supporting the semi-finished product 2 particularly when the latter is solely made of an elastomeric material and does not possess any reinforcing structure.
  • Said element 12 therefore prevents that the semi-finished product 2 may undergo to undulations or bends which may cause stretches and/or deformations of the material in the space comprised between the rolls 17 and 19.
  • Figure 4 shows an additional embodiment of the supplying apparatus 10 according to the present invention, in which the path followed by the release fabric 5 is different from that shown in Figure 2.
  • the release fabric 5 is not detached from the semi-finished product 2 at the first roll 17, but at the second roll 18.
  • the semi-finished product, still coupled to the release fabric 5 travels along a surface portion of both rolls 17 and 18, and the detachment from said release fabric 5 takes place at the second roll 18 and not at the roll 17, as described above.
  • the feeding spool 6 is driven together with the rolls 17, 18, 19 and the beam 20.
  • Figure 4 partly shows also the festoon formed by the semi-finished product 2 (for example, a belt strip) arranged downstream of the supplying apparatus 10. More in detail, Figure 4 shows a festoon of maximum width 2' and a festoon of minimum width 2", the length of which is controlled by a pair of photoelectric cells 50; which read the height of the bend formed by the festoon. According to such reading, the aforementioned photoelectric cells adjust the festoon length, actuating and deactivating the supplying apparatus so as to maintain, upstream of the assembly drum, the necessary amount of semi-finished product for ensuring the continuity of the manufacturing process in case of replacement of the feeding spool or in case of failure on the line.
  • the semi-finished product 2 for example, a belt strip
  • the devices of the supplying apparatus according to the present invention are arranged in a casing 24 removably connectable to the assembly plant and, more particularly, to the frame of the feeding apparatus of each specific semi-finished product to an assembly drum.
  • the casing 24 enables a quick change of the entire supplying apparatus 10 whenever, for example, maintenance operations are required, or whenever the assembly machine, to which such apparatus 10 is coupled, must change its production and meet the requirements of dimensional and/or shape variation of the semi-finished product 2 to be sent to the assembly drum 3.
  • the apparatus according to the present invention eliminates the aforementioned several operations and the consequent technical times required for carrying out a change of the semi-finished product. In fact, in order to immediately shift from an operating cycle to a different subsequent cycle it is simply necessary to remove the casing 24 and replace the same with a new casing 24, containing the new type of desired semi-finished product, regardless of whether the old casing has ended the spool 6 or whether the new casing is provided with a new spool 6.
  • the casing 24 comprises a frame 25 on which the shaft of the storing spool 6 with the respective spool, the shaft of the collecting beam 20 with the respective beam, the shafts of the rolls 17, 18, 19 with the same rolls, and the axes of a plurality of idle rolls for supporting the semi-finished product up to the outlet from the casing are mounted.
  • At least the shafts of the spool 6, of the beam 20 and of the roll 17 are integrally rotatably connectable with respective actuation pins mounted on the frame 26 of the feeding apparatus, upstream of the assembly drum, which in addition to the motors for driving said pins further comprises the braking device 7 of the spool 6, and a computerized system 31 for the synchronized control of said devices.
  • the casing 24 is mounted on said frame 26 by associating said shafts to the corresponding pins perpendicularly protruding from said frame: the supplying process of the semi-finished product is thus carried out with no substantial differences with respect to what previously described.
  • the casing is replaced with another casing provided with a new storing spool. If the semi-finished product supply must be interrupted when the spool is partly loaded, for example because of a product change or of other reasons, the casing is removed without any need of rewinding the release fabric on the spool 6; the same casing may be reused on the same or another assembly plant starting again without delays from the condition in which the casing was previously removed from the feeder.
  • Table 1 shows the values of the main operating parameters of an apparatus 10 according to the invention, used for respectively supplying the sidewalls and the liner of a tire.
  • a computerized system controls the operation of the apparatus 10 according to the predetermined production method.
  • said system adjusts the rotation speed of the storing spool 6 by means of a braking device 7 as a function of the amount of unwound semi-finished product.
  • Said computerized system acts on the braking device 7 by maintaining the release fabric permanently in tension but simultaneously varying the rotation speed of the spool 6, preferably according to a predetermined law, as the quantity of supplied semi-finished product varies, so as to ensure a constant and predetermined flow of semifinished product to the assembly drum.
  • One object of the supplying apparatus 10, in fact, is that of being capable of supplying the semi-finished product 2 at a constant speed equal to the speed which the latter has at the assembly drum, speed which in said last portion of path is imparted to the semifinished product by the rotation of the motorized rolls 22.
  • the adjustment of the rotation speed of the spool 6 may be obtained, for example, by providing the braking device 7 with a plurality of photoelectric cells arranged in front of a face of the spool, and with a luminous source arranged in front of the other face of the spool.
  • the photoelectric cells are progressively illuminated by the luminous source and transmit to the computerized system the measure of the current diameter of the spool still loaded with the semi-finished product. In this way, the computerized system corrects the spool rotation speed on the basis of the emptying level reached.
  • the computerized system controls the motor 21 which controls the speed of the collecting beam 20 by means of a clutch device, so that the pulling action exerted on the release fabric 5 is constant in time without being affected by the mass variation which the beam 20 withstands due to the increase of the amount of collected release fabric.
  • the adjustment of the rotation speed of the beam 20, i.e. the decrease of the value thereof while the release fabric is being wound, allows to transfer the semifinished product 2 at a constant and predetermined speed without creating undesired stretches in the material since the release fabric is inextensible according to the invention.
  • the constant transfer speed of the semi-finished product is also obtained thanks to the motorization of at least one roll of the apparatus 10 according to the invention.
  • motorization enables to complement the pulling action exerted by the beam 20 on the release fabric 5 to which the semi-fmished product 2 is coupled, thus facilitating the conveying of the latter without undesired stretches towards the assembly drum 3.
  • the computerized system 31 receives the real data of the parameters concerned (speed, positions and pulls mentioned above) during the steps of the assembling process; the computerized system carries out the necessary corrections for restoring the apparatus operation to the programmed conditions by comparing the stored data and the real data, in the presence of possible deviations from predetermined threshold values.
  • the method and the apparatus according to the present invention enable to accomplish a supply of a semi-fmished product without creating stretches in the semi-fmished product and causing dimensional variations of the same along the path comprised between the storing spool 6 and the assembly drum 3.
  • the semi-finished product is a carcass ply
  • the absence of longitudinal dilatations ensures that the metal cords forming the ply are arranged, during the step of configuring the carcass, with the predetermined density calculated for obtaining a predetermined resistance of the carcass in the tire operating conditions.
  • the apparatus 10 may comprise a different number of rolls with respect to what is illustrated in the figures, only two rolls or even more than three, provided that at least one is motorized, and the overall arrangement of the rolls is such as to impart a tension on the release fabric capable of transferring, without stretches, the semi-finished product 2 towards the assembly drum 3.

Abstract

L'invention concerne un appareil servant à diriger un produit semi-fini en élastomère vers un poste d'emballage et/ou d'assemblage d'un article en caoutchouc. Plus particulièrement, le poste d'assemblage est un poste d'assemblage de pneumatiques. Le produit semi-fini est associé à une couche de protection non extensible à la traction. L'ensemble formé par le produit semi-fini et la couche de protection est enroulé autour d'une bobine de stockage et d'alimentation associée à un dispositif de freinage. Cet appareil comprend des dispositifs de séparation, dont au moins l'un est motorisé, utilisés pour séparer le produit semi-fini de la couche de protection, celle-ci étant enroulée une deuxième fois autour d'une bobine collectrice entraînée par moteur.
